HOUSTON — Governor Greg Abbott today outlined his Five-Point Property Tax relief plan to a packed room of Texas voters at a Taxpayer Empowerment Event in Houston. The Governor was joined by Representative Mano DeAyala, Representative Charles Cunningham, Representative Lacey Hull, Representative Mike Schofield, Representative Valoree Swanson, Representative Terri Leo Wilson, Commissioner Tom Ramsey, and Americans for Prosperity State Director Genevieve Collins.

“We know the burden Texans are facing because of skyrocketing local property taxes and rising costs,” said Governor Abbott. “We are here to cut taxes for families and small businesses and ensure they can keep more of their hard earned money. That is why we passed a $125,000 property tax exemption so small businesses can keep more of their money, hire more employees, expand their operations, and get relief from skyrocketing local property taxes.”

As the 8th largest economy in the world, Texas remains one of the most affordable states in the nation, with no income tax, no death tax, no capital gains tax, and no state property tax. Governor Abbott remains committed to driving down local property taxes, expanding homestead protections, and advancing conservative fiscal policies that keep Texas the best place in America to live, work, and raise a family.

Governor Abbott’s 5-Point Property Tax Relief Plan calls for:

  • Common Sense Local Spending Limits
  • Two-Thirds Voter Approval for Tax Increases
  • Empowering Voters to Roll Back Taxes
  • Appraisal Predictability and Cap Appraisal Growth
  • Elimination of School Property Taxes for Homeowners
